Transaction 156c5f2fe4936bc9670d1283c1c1a463c057ffe66926568e28911e68a4e6c5d1

1 Input
1 Outputs
  • 156c5f2fe4936bc9670d1283c1c1a463c057ffe66926568e28911e68a4e6c5d1:0
  • value  436173
    address  3P12UpxzcNGnmdbCY7iVhCEkv12LZF3LW6